Advanced Training Strategies
As you advance in OSCIOS Sports, you can explore more advanced training strategies. One example is interval training, which involves alternating between high-intensity bursts and periods of rest or low-intensity activity. It is useful for improving speed and endurance. Another strategy is periodization, which is the systematic planning of training phases. It varies the intensity and volume of your workouts over time to peak at the right moment. Consider incorporating these strategies to further enhance your performance. Don't underestimate the power of mental preparation. Visualization, positive self-talk, and stress management techniques can significantly impact your performance. Practice these techniques to boost your confidence and focus.
Nutrition and Hydration: Fueling Your Body
Proper nutrition and hydration are vital for fueling your body and maximizing your performance in OSCIOS Sports. Your diet should provide the energy you need, support muscle recovery, and help you stay healthy. A balanced diet should include a variety of nutrient-rich foods. This includes lean proteins, complex carbohydrates, healthy fats, fruits, and vegetables. Protein is essential for muscle repair and growth, so include it in every meal. Carbohydrates are your primary energy source. Choose complex carbs like whole grains, and limit processed foods. Healthy fats are important for hormone production and overall health. Drink plenty of water throughout the day. Dehydration can lead to fatigue, muscle cramps, and decreased performance. Aim to drink water before, during, and after your training sessions. Consider using electrolyte drinks to replenish the minerals you lose through sweat, especially during long or intense workouts.
The Importance of Supplements
Supplements can be beneficial for athletes. However, it's essential to consult with a healthcare professional or a registered dietitian before taking any supplements. They can help you determine which supplements are right for you and whether they're safe. Some common supplements include protein powders, creatine, and pre-workout formulas. Protein powders can aid in muscle recovery. Creatine can enhance strength and power. Pre-workout formulas can boost energy and focus. But remember, supplements should never replace a balanced diet. They should be used to support your overall nutrition plan.

Common Injuries and How to Prevent Them
Injuries are a common part of OSCIOS Sports, but you can take steps to minimize the risk. Warm up properly before each workout. Include dynamic stretches to increase blood flow and prepare your muscles for activity. Cool down with static stretches after each workout. This will help reduce muscle soreness and improve flexibility. Prioritize proper form and technique in all your exercises. This will prevent injuries. Work with a coach or trainer to learn the correct techniques. Gradually increase the intensity and duration of your training sessions. This will allow your body to adapt and prevent overuse injuries. Listen to your body and take rest days when needed. Ignoring pain or pushing through fatigue can lead to serious injuries.
